About Barnstorm
Barnstorm is an Emmy and VES-nominated visual effects studio based in Los Angeles and operations in Vancouver, Montreal, and NYC. We provide photo-realistic visual effects for a variety of episodic and select sequences in feature films. We pride ourselves in our artists’ talent and dedication to producing world-class visual effects.
Who You Are
You are an experienced Nuke Compositor ready to jump into an exciting studio environment with a wide variety of projects. You have an advanced knowledge of Nuke Compositing techniques and a firm photographic grasp of light, depth of field, distortion, and motion blur. You have a strong creative vision and want to contribute those skills to a growing team and company.
What You’ll Do
- Effectively and seamlessly integrate elements with production footage, using rotoscoping, keying, painting, tracking, and other compositing techniques
- Along with Leads, Supervisors, and other artists, collaborate with other departments to complete assigned tasks under tight deadlines and fast turnaround times.
- Deliver consistently high-quality work and troubleshoot technical problems on assigned shots.
- Strive for excellence in terms of aesthetic and technical work.
- Take direction from Compositing Supervisors, Leads and VFX Producers to execute clients' vision to the highest standards.
What You Bring
- 3+ years working in a VFX studio environment
- Advance knowledge of Nuke
- Mocha, Silhouette, experience preferred
- An ability to work well within a team, with strong verbal and written communication skills.
- Strong problem-solving skills and the ability to thrive in a fast-paced, dynamic environment.
- A thorough understanding of both feature film and television VFX production pipelines
- An ability to interpret supervisor and client notes
About This Role
Note: At this time we are only accepting applications from those artists legally eligible to work in Canada and reside in NY.
This is a remote based role. Note: At this time we are only accepting applications from those artists legally eligible to work in the USA, located in NY.